Jason A. Brown, Vice President

Jason Brown is a vice president at Hermanoff & Associates, where he is responsible for managing and executing corporate and product-focused public relations programs for clients in the retail, financial, real estate and restaurant industries.
While at Hermanoff & Associates, Brown specializes in media relations for B2B and B2C clients, increasing awareness of their leadership and key offerings among targeted audiences. Campaigns have focused on generating influence and awareness within both the business decision maker and consumer arenas.
Prior to joining Hermanoff & Associates, Brown gained considerable experience working at three Detroit-based public relations agencies, where he functioned as a media relations specialist.  He has developed and managed communications programs and projects for leading business and technology companies, such as eBay and Microsoft and also spent significant time working on various General Motors project work.
Brown is extremely connected with local, regional and national media.  Among the highlights of his accomplishments include placing various regionally-based clients in front of the national media spotlight.  Brown has secured national placements in Business Week, Wall Street Journal, New York Times, Entrepreneur, Inc. and Fortune Small Business.
Outside of the agency, Brown is an active member of the Detroit Chapter of the Public Relations Society of America, Brown has also previously served as a pro-bono media consultant to a local non-profit organization, Forgotten Harvest, which rescues perishable food in Oakland, Wayne and Macomb County.
Brown is a graduate of Michigan State University, where he earned a bachelor of arts in Journalism.  He currently resides in Oak Park, Michigan with his wife Hope, daughter Eliza, and dog, Maddie.
